Editors say that before submitting to their literary magazine, you should read a recent issue. But why? How exactly will that help?
In this session, we'll do a close reading of four prominent literary magazines to unearth their unwritten submission guidelines-- meaning what they really publish in terms of style and subjects. From the editors of those magazines, we'll share publishing statistics, break-in genres, as well as personal pet peeves and guilty pleasures. Bring a page of your writing, and as a group, we can decide which of the magazines may be the best fit.
